Scope and content
SUPPLIED TITLE OF TAPE(S): Carrie M. Cates : volunteer service versus professionalism - North Vancouver experience PERIOD COVERED: 1910-1972 RECORDED: North Vancouver (B.C.), 1973-04-05 SUMMARY: Carrie M. Cates was born in 1905 in Canoe, B.C. and she discusses small town life; schooling; move to North Vancouver in 1918; mother's work as a practical nurse; work as a secretary; North Vancouver in the 1920s; Chinese immigrants. TRACK 2: Marriage and children; PTA and other volunteer work; running for North Vancouver City Council in 1962; elected Mayor of North Vancouver in 1964; views on the role of women, society and politics.
